Good point, John. I always forget these functions, but they're very useful for handling large amounts of text. Just be sure you delete the temporary file when you're done with it.

Barbara

>Hi Mauricio
>
>What Barbara mentioned about the 254 characters is true. If your queries are long you are going to run into trouble unless you string together several macro's.
>
>If your queries are going to be this long, another solution for you to consider is to use the strtofile() and filetostr() functions. Here you can just keep adding the properly formatted text that makes up the query to one file. When you are ready to execute use the filetostr() function, and then delete the file.
